Lymington Town Train Station boasts a variety of amenities aimed at making your journey smoother and more comfortable. Ticket purchasing and collection are straightforward with a ticket office that operates from early in the morning till mid-day on weekdays and has slightly reduced hours over the weekend. There are also ticket machines for picking up pre-booked tickets, designed to cater to those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
The station is fully accessible, with step-free access across all areas. Although the station lacks a waiting room with heating, the seating areas in the booking hall provide enough space for a pause before continuing your journey. However, the station lacks certain amenities such as luggage storage and accessible toilets.
The station is conveniently connected with other forms of transport to facilitate an onward journey into the charming surroundings or beyond. For local bus connections, including rail replacement services, the Gosport Street bus stop outside Meridian Electrical is available.
